Maryam Sanda: Nigerians Show No Sympathy As ‘Killer Wife’ Gets Death Sentence

Maryam Sanda’s conviction by death has been described as “justice at last” for her late husband, Bilyaminu Bello, whom she killed on November 19, 2017, by stabbing him to death.

Nigerians took to twitter to hail Sanda’s conviction by a Federal Capital Territory (FCT) High Court on Monday.

Justice Yusuf Halilu found Sanda, who is nursing a daughter, guilty on two-count of homicide and consequently sentenced her to death by hanging.

Her late husband was the nephew of a former National Chairman of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Haliru Mohammed Bello.

THE WHISTLER had reported how Sanda was said to have murdered Bilyanu barely few days to his 36th birthday.

Some Nigerians who reacted to her conviction on Twitter, expressed excitement at the judgement.

One Twitter user, Sally Suleiman (@is_salsu), said: “Happy to read the news that Maryam Sanda who killed her husband has been convicted. This serves as a warning to all those planning to kill their spouse, you will rot in jail and probably die by hanging. Leave the marriage if you have issues. Don’t kill your husband or wife.”
